Antonio Brown arrested for failure to pay child support.

Former NFL wide receiver Antonio Brown was arrested for failing to pay child support, with his former partner claiming he owes close to $31,000. Brown, who has a history of legal issues, was released after posting a $15,000 bond.

Dick Butkus, Chicago Bears linebacker and Hall of Famer, dies at 80

Dick Butkus, the iconic Chicago Bears player, has died at the age of 80. Butkus was known for his toughness and determination on the field, and went on to have a successful career in Hollywood. He was ranked as the second greatest Bear of all time in a 2019 Tribune list. Butkus was inducted into the Pro Football Hall of Fame in 1979 and the College Football Hall of Fame in 1978. He was also known for his philanthropy, particularly his work to combat performance-enhancing drugs in sports.

Gov. DeSantis appoints Trump admin lawyer as chair of Elections Commission

Florida Governor Ron DeSantis has appointed Chad Mizelle, a lawyer who served under former President Donald Trump, as the new Chair of the Florida Elections Commission. Mizelle is the chief legal officer of Affinity Partners, a global investment firm founded by Trump's son-in-law Jared Kushner. DeSantis also reappointed two members to the Commission, one of whom donated $50,000 to a super PAC supporting DeSantis' presidential campaign. The appointments are subject to Senate approval.

Texas AG Ken Paxton pleads not guilty at impeachment trial, departs as arguments commence

The impeachment trial of Texas Attorney General Ken Paxton has begun, putting Republicans in a difficult position. Paxton, who has faced felony charges and an FBI investigation, has remained popular among hard-right Republicans by aligning himself with Donald Trump. The trial is rare in its attempt to hold a member of the party accountable for alleged wrongdoing.

Bitcoin price drops 8% amidst ongoing cryptocurrency decline

Bitcoin's price fell by nearly 8% in an hour of frenzied trading, erasing most of its gains since June. The sell-off coincided with news that Elon Musk's SpaceX had written down the value of its bitcoin holdings by $373mn and sold the cryptocurrency. The volatility comes as US regulators crack down on the sector and as expectations of interest rate cuts by the Federal Reserve are reassessed.

"The Blind Side Tuohy Family Countersued by NFL Star in Absurd and Hurtful Lawsuit"

NFL star Michael Oher has filed a petition claiming that the family who inspired the film The Blind Side misled him about his adoption and enriched themselves at his expense. Oher has asked for the conservatorship to be terminated and for a full accounting of the money earned from his story. The family denies the claims, calling them "hurtful and absurd."
